Eland Slayer
Outdoor Visions has the best selection but many of their DVD's are severely overpriced. For instance, I have all of Jack Brittingham's DVD's, but I bought them from JackBrittingham.com where they are either $15.95 or $21.95. At Outdoor Visions, they are all $39.95 so don't buy them from Outdoor Visions.

MJines
Another vote for the Buzz video. I have watched it three times now and learn something new every time.

Also, a while back I bought the Capstick Hunting Collection. Includes six DVDs of Capstick hunting different animals. Most are so so. I watched the Hunting the African Elephant one and it was actually pretty good. What was neat was that it featured the bush people and showed things like them making poison for arrows out of a caterpillar larvae, cooking an ostrich egg in a hole in the ground and things like not. Much more entertaining than most of the others in the series.
